JOB ANNOUNCEMENT
Leonard Carder, LLP – Oakland
Associate Counsel – ERISA/Employee Benefits

Leonard Carder, LLP, based in Oakland, California, is looking for attorneys with 3-5+ years’  experience/interest in employee benefits law and a demonstrated commitment to the goals of  workers’ rights and the labor movement. Ideal candidates should have ERISA experience and  familiarity with multiemployer defined benefit pension plans, defined contribution plans and  

welfare benefit plans. Other specific experience with governmental plans, QDROs, subrogation  and trust fund collections will be considered. In addition, strong research, writing and analytical  skills, as well as the ability to work effectively with unions, multiemployer trust funds, and plan  participants is essential.  

For more than 80 years, Leonard Carder has aided unions and workers involved in some of the  most memorable labor struggles on the West Coast and has championed workers’ rights in  precedent-setting litigation. We represent local and international labor unions and employee  benefit plans, as well as representing employees in class actions, individual workers’ rights  cases, and law reform litigation. 

The salary range for ERISA associate attorneys with at least three years of experience in  employee benefits work is between $111,500 and $150,000 annually, depending on bar passage  and experience. Associate attorneys are also eligible for loan repayment up to $4,000 per year  and annual bonuses. Leonard Carder provides a comprehensive benefits package including  health, dental, vision, life insurance, long-term disability insurance, and cell phone  reimbursement. After one year of employment, associate attorneys are eligible for Leonard  Carder’s 401k plan, with employer contributions.
